[0052] figure 1 Shown is a heat pump system 2 for a vehicle not shown in detail, in particular for an electric vehicle or a hybrid vehicle. The heat pump system 2 includes a refrigeration circuit 4 in which a refrigerant circulates, and a coolant circuit 6 in which a coolant, such as a water / glycol mixture, circulates. Refrigeration circuit 4 in figure 1 is indicated by a dashed line, and the coolant circuit 6 is indicated by a solid line. The coolant circuit 6 is a cooling circuit in which the coolant generally has a temperature between approximately -25°C to +70°C or even up to +90°C. The heat pump system 2 also includes an air conditioning device 8 for air conditioning the passenger compartment 10 , ie the interior of the compartment. To this end, the air conditioning device 8 has an air conditioning evaporator 12 connected to the refrigeration circuit 4 and a heating heat exchanger 14 connected to the coolant circuit 6 .
